Sediment mangrove, Bacteria of MFC, Phenotypic CharacteristicsAbstract
The purpose of this research were to acquire the isolate and to determine the identity of bacteria that potentially as Microbial Fuel Cell (MFC). The bacteria MFC of sediment mangrove isolated by using pour method in Nutrient Agar (NA) media. Characterization isolate did phenotipically based on morphological, biochemical and physiological character. Coloni morphological that observed that are NA media and cell morphological (shape,characteristik Gram and motility). Biochemical characteristic that observed including the use of citrate, gelatin hydrolisis, amylolytic characteristik, cellulolitic characteristtik and carbohidrates fermentation rom various of sugars (sucrose, glucose and lactose). Physiological characteristic includes necessary of oxygen, tolerance of temperature, NaCl and pH. The result of this research obtained as much as 12 bacteria isolates. The bacterial characteristic that obtained that is all strains has shape is steam,Gram positive and charachteristic is motile.
